Waking up early can be hard, especially for those of us who arent morning people. But rising early can be the secret to a more productive day. Lets count the ways: More time, fewer interruptions. We all could use a few more hours in the day, and waking up early gives you that time, often without distractions. In the early morning hours, its often quiet, which can allow for better focus, intention and planning of the day without the distraction of emails, phone calls or social/personal obligation
Around 50% of healthcare workers reported feeling burned out in 2023. This shows that the levels of burnout in this particular industry are at critical levels. And it's not only burnout, 80% of healthcare professionals quit primarily because they don't feel appreciated. Based on the available data, you can now see how burnout is inevitably related to appreciation.

The plight of the middle manager has taken a turn for the worse since the pandemic, leaving many in the role prone to burnout as they juggle competing expectations with limited support from their employers. Managers were already tasked with addressing low morale and absorbing additional work as companies have been hit with layoffs in recent yearsbut now a number of employers are more pointedly culling their ranks, too.
